Max Zaska
musician
Max Zaska is a prominent figure in Ireland's neosoul music scene, acclaimed for his innovative blend of jazz, hip-hop, funk, and R&B. His third album showcases a creative range, featuring collaborations that contribute to an infectious summer soundtrack.
